At nearly 100 years old, Route 66—the Main Street of America—evokes memories of roadside attractions, rock on the radio and road trips with the family where the journey was as much fun as the destination. In Arizona, more than 385 miles of the route exist within the state, including an impressive 158 unbroken miles across Western Arizona, from Topock to Crookton Road near Ash Fork.
Communities along Arizona’s Route 66 include Topock, Oatman, Kingman, Hackberry, Valentine, Truxton, Peach Springs, Seligman, Ash Fork, Williams, Flagstaff, Winona, Winslow, Joseph City, Holbrook and Lupton.
